Abstract

3D Smart Maps are an initiative of Adikara firm aimed to provide a navigation tool which will help navigate even illiterate people in a temporary town (Sadhugram) made for the sadhus and pilgrims who will come to take a holy bath in river Godavari during Nashik-KUMBH 2015 (Kumbh is largest peaceful gathering in the World). Fifty-two Maps were provided throughout Sadhugram (i.e. in 375 acres) for this purpose, and the Maps were designed so that it can even be read by illiterate people and were very easy to understand and be interpreted.
